Skip to content
Snippets Groups Projects
Commit 994eb8b6 authored by chris's avatar chris
Browse files

fix substance selection

parent 9cb84e93
No related branches found
No related tags found
No related merge requests found
......@@ -16,14 +16,17 @@ class TrackChangeComponent extends AnnotationComponent {
ShowAdditions = 'sc-track-add-show'
}
const accept = $$('a').addClass('sc-track-item')
.on('click', this.acceptTrackChange)
.append('accept')
const reject = $$('a').addClass('sc-track-item')
.on('click', this.rejectTrackChange)
.append('reject')
const seperator = $$('span').addClass('sc-track-separator')
.append(' / ')
const accept = $$('a')
.addClass('sc-track-item-accept')
.on('click', this.acceptTrackChange)
const reject = $$('a')
.addClass('sc-track-item-reject')
.on('click', this.rejectTrackChange)
const seperator = $$('span')
.addClass('sc-track-item-separator')
const container = $$('span').addClass('sc-accept-reject-container')
.append(accept)
.append(seperator)
......
......@@ -10,6 +10,7 @@ class TrackChangeControlCommand extends Command {
return newState
}
execute (params, context) {
console.log('in execute')
const surface = context.surfaceManager.getSurface('body')
surface.send('trackChangesUpdate')
return true
......
......@@ -2,13 +2,18 @@ $blue: #4a90e2;
$red: #f00;
$yellow: #f7f70c;
.sc-track-change {
// background-color: #f7f70c;
.se-selection-fragment {
.sc-accept-reject-container:only-of-type {
display: none;
}
}
.sc-track-change-add {
color: $blue;
// display: inline-block;
text-decoration: none;
}
......@@ -25,23 +30,39 @@ $yellow: #f7f70c;
color: inherit !important;
.sc-accept-reject-container {
display: none;
}
display: none;
}
}
.sc-accept-reject-container {
display: inline-block;
.sc-track-item-accept::after {
color: $blue;
content: 'accept';
cursor: pointer;
display: inline-flex;
font-size: 14px;
margin-left: -90px;
margin-top: 20px;
position: absolute;
}
.sc-track-item {
color: $blue;
cursor: pointer;
}
.sc-track-item-separator::after {
color: $blue;
content: '/';
cursor: default;
display: inline-flex;
font-size: 14px;
margin-left: -45px;
margin-top: 20px;
position: absolute;
}
.sc-track-separator {
color: $blue;
}
.sc-track-item-reject::after {
color: $blue;
content: 'reject';
cursor: pointer;
display: inline-flex;
font-size: 14px;
margin-left: -35px;
margin-top: 20px;
position: absolute;
}
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ment